Output 6184dd1bc53a03df19ae6c5acd3b04181091b26b8a104a1492fa7b0057a10511:1

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ebc1a669dbef2f44283bd4eb5e42d318499389d6 OP_EQUAL
address
3PBahfYqQwi6GxkPuk4pYdwppz3LSpB464
transaction
6184dd1bc53a03df19ae6c5acd3b04181091b26b8a104a1492fa7b0057a10511
spent
true